Actually, you're not far off. I think a better way to do this, is to have an "Auth" page prior to sending the user to the Splash page. The "Auth" page will require all of the following info:

1. First/Last Name
2. Last 4 of Social
3. Billing Address
4. Log IP address
5. Check the "I Agree" box to the site terms.
6. Set a cookie w/ this info, and call it later on the join page.

If all paysites did this, and you still got chargebacks, you could dispute it w/ the CC company, and get it sent back to the customer and charged as "valid".

Once the user hits your "Members" page, log the IP, and timestamp into a database, as "Viewed" by the specific user. You have now accepted payment, and provided a service. There is no way in hell they can dispute it.

Also, on the members page, you can let the surfer know that their information has been recorded and logged into a database, and that any attempt to chargeback will be disputed. And you may persue criminal fraud charges against them if the attempt is made, holding the surfer liable for all court and attorney fees.

Once they make payment and enter the members area... They have accepted the terms of the "binding" contract, and by law must abide by them.
